Why three engines
Tender documents are the worst documents in the world: broken tables, skewed scans, stamps over figures. A lone engine returns a number with the same confident face whether it's right or not.
Three independent engines read the same document and consensus exposes disagreement. When all three agree, you move on. When they don't, the field is flagged and a human decides. Doubt stops hiding inside a "data point" and becomes an explicit decision.
